The Goulburn Regional Art Gallery will receive a grant of almost $125,000 to redevelop its front entrance.

The $124,499 grant was announced this week as part of the NSW Government’s Infrastructure Grants Program.

The program re-invests profits from registered club’s gaming machines to support local organisations, community groups and charities.

The grants are awarded in four categories – Arts and Culture, Community Infrastructure, Disaster Readiness and Sports and Recreation.

A total of $6.4 million was handed out to 39 projects across the four different categories.

Minister for Gaming and Racing David Harris congratulated the grant recipients and wished them well “as they undertake these worthy projects to benefit their communities.

Advertisement

He said the grants would support local communities to create or upgrade facilities that bring people together to strengthen relationships, increase health and well-being through participation in sport, recreation and the arts and to prepare and respond to natural disasters.
